Tahini and Carob Molasses (V)

Tahini and carob syrup go together deliciously in this easy snack or appetiser. Great with pita bread dipped in it. It can also be made as one of the dishes in a Lebanese meze.

Ingredients
 

  • 72 g (4 tbsp) runny hulled tahini
  • 10 ml (2 tsp) carob syrup
  • 1 small pita bread sliced

Instructions
 

  • Pour tahini into a small dish.
  • Drizzle carob syrup over tahini with a teaspoon, making a nice drizzle effect.
  • Serve with pita bread. I like to make my pita bread warm in the microwave.

Notes

*Use hulled tahini as it’s much better in taste than unhulled which is more bitter. Use tahini brand that you like as the taste can be quite different across the brands. You can find which brand I use in the post, where I discuss my favourite vegan food products.
